Alex Salmond’s Alba Party will now decide whether Humza Yousaf is forced to resign as
First Minister as the Scottish Greens said they would vote against him in a confidence vote
at Holyrood.

Scottish Labour announce plan to force early Holyrood election

Anas Sarwar has announced Labour will try to force a vote of no confidence in the whole Scottish Government as Humza Yousaf fights to save his political life.

Mr Yousaf, the First Minister of Scotland, is facing a vote of no confidence on his leadership next week but Mr Sarwar, the Scottish Labour leader, said this morning he will seek a broader vote in an attempt to force an early Holyrood election.

He told LBC: “I think it is now a matter of when, not if Humza Yousaf resigns as First Minister. But I think it would be completely untenable for the SNP to presume they can impose another unelected first minister on Scotland.

“That is why Scottish Labour has said already we don’t have confidence in Humza Yousaf.

“But today we will also be laying a motion before Parliament saying that the Scottish Parliament does not have confidence in this Scottish Government because ultimately I think it is the people of Scotland that should decide who leads this country not just a small group of SNP members.”
